Eliza Labs and IoTeX Join Forces to Build the First DePIN-Aware AI Agent

In a move that signals the accelerating convergence of artificial intelligence and decentralized infrastructure, Eliza Labs and IoTeX announced a strategic partnership on January 9, 2025, to develop SENTAI — the world’s first DePIN-aware AI agent. Built on Eliza OS and powered by the IoTeX network, the project represents a significant leap forward in how autonomous AI agents interact with real-world physical infrastructure.

The Synergy

The collaboration between Eliza Labs and IoTeX addresses a fundamental gap in the AI agent ecosystem: the disconnect between digital intelligence and physical-world data. While existing AI agents operate primarily within the bounds of on-chain data and web APIs, SENTAI integrates directly with IoTeX’s Decentralized Physical Infrastructure Network (DePIN), enabling the agent to access, process, and act upon real-time data from physical sensors, computing nodes, and infrastructure devices deployed worldwide.

Shaw, co-founder of ai16z, publicly expressed enthusiasm for the DePIN AI Agent concept, highlighting its transformative potential despite being in early development stages. His endorsement carries weight in the space, as ai16z has emerged as a leading investor and incubator in the AI-crypto intersection.

AI Use Cases in Web3

The SENTAI agent demonstrates several compelling use cases at the intersection of AI and Web3 infrastructure. DePIN networks generate massive volumes of real-world data — from weather stations and air quality monitors to compute resource availability and energy grid performance. An AI agent capable of autonomously processing this data can optimize resource allocation, predict infrastructure failures, and facilitate trustless coordination between network participants.

BINOAI, the first implementation built on this framework, launched as the world’s first DePIN AI Agent powered by Eliza OS. The introduction of the $SENTAI token generated immediate market interest, recording a 24-hour trading volume of $63 million and ranking as the third most traded token on the Solana chain at the time. On-chain data revealed that an address associated with Shaw purchased 8.5 million $SENTAI for 996 SOL, demonstrating significant confidence in the project’s trajectory.

Data Privacy Implications

The integration of AI agents with DePIN infrastructure raises important questions about data privacy and sovereignty. When an autonomous agent processes real-world sensor data from distributed networks, the questions of who owns the derived insights and how individual privacy is protected become critical. IoTeX’s decentralized architecture provides a framework for addressing these concerns by ensuring that data remains under the control of its original providers rather than centralized intermediaries.

The partnership emphasizes that projects utilizing Eliza on the IoTeX chain receive priority integration support, and ai16z is establishing dedicated grants to fund the advancement of DePIN AI agents. This structured approach to ecosystem development suggests a long-term commitment to responsible innovation in the space.
